Handing off the Quillbus broker upgrade (4.x to 5.1) to Dario. Cluster is half-migrated; mixed-version mode is supported but TLS cert rotation must finish before cutover. No auth model changes, though the admin API gained two new endpoints worth reviewing. Open questions and the migration checklist are tracked on the internal page below.

dashboard of taduf-bawef = https://jira.lumicsys.internal/projects/display/browse/b1cbf89d

Onboarding: Pixelbin image cache leak. Known issue: thumbnail cache in Pixelbin 4.2 never evicts decoded frames; memory climbs ~200MB/hour under load. Symptom: OOM kills on render nodes, customers report blank galleries. Workaround: restart the cache daemon; fix ships in 4.3. Escalate to the Render pod if restarts exceed three per shift. To restart, you need access to the cache admin vault. Unlock it with the recovery passphrase below.

vault phrase of bagaf-kajeg = jorath-feniel-briir-siliel-ralix

I'm passing Sproutly maintenance over before my move to the Ferngate project. The scheduler runs on a fifteen-minute tick and reads moisture thresholds from the Loamworks config store; if a greenhouse controller misses two ticks, it fails safe and skips watering rather than double-dosing. Known quirk: daylight-saving transitions can shift schedules by an hour until the next sync, which generates predictable support tickets each spring and autumn. Escalations for stuck valves or schedule drift should be routed to the new owner named below.

approver of bajeg-bajef = Istion Pelys Holax Wenox

## Service Accounts — StormFan Alert Fan-Out

The fan-out worker authenticates to the internal dispatch tier using the svc-stormfan account. Rotate quarterly; scopes are limited to publish-only on alert topics. If deliveries stall during your shift, verify the worker is using the current credential, reproduced below for reference.

API key for kaweg-hahif: kto4_rAjZ